{Katie’s Kitchen} One Pan Andouille Sausage and Vegetables

Pre-heat the oven to 450 degrees.

Start by preparing your vegetables. You can use whatever you have in the fridge. I had- asparagus, sliced mushrooms, a bell pepper, russet (or gold) potatoes, yellow/white onion; you can also use green beans. Chop everything up and place on your large sheet pan!

Then, coin your andouille sausage. Put on top of vegetables.

In a small mixing bowl- 1/3 cup of olive oil, 1tsp. oregano, 1tsp., dried thyme, 1tsp. garlic salt, 1 clove minced garlic, salt and pepper to taste.

Pour the seasoning mix over top of everything on the sheet pan and toss to coat evenly.

Place pan in the oven and bake at 450 for 30 minutes.

Ingredients:

-1 andouille sausgae

-3-4 russet potatoes

-1 lb. of green beans

-1 bell pepper

-1 cup of sliced mushrooms (or baby portobello)

-asparagus, white onion, other veggies you like to add.

For seasoning:

-1/3 cup of olive oil

-1tsp. oregano,

-1tsp. dried thyme

-1tsp. garlic salt

-1 clove minced garlic

-salt and pepper to taste
